Answer:
110 and 70
Step-by-step explanation:
opposite sides of parallelograms are equal so you can set 2x+30 equal to 5x-90
when you do this:
2x+30=5x-90
-2x -2x
30=3x-90
+90 +90
120=3x
/3 /3
40=x
now you can plug 40 in for 5x-90
example:
5(40)-90
200-90
110
m<r=110
<r and <s are supplementary because they are consecutive angles
supplementary is when two angles add up to 180
since <r is 110, do 180-110 and get 70
m<s = 70

Let's find the difference between each number.
38-14=24
74-38=36
122-74=48
182-122=60
254-182=72
As you can tell, you're adding 12 to each difference before. The next difference would be 72+12=84. Let's add.
254+84=338
Now the next difference would be 84+12=96.
338+96=434
So, the next two terms are 338 and 434.
